Biphenyl Market
also known as diphenyl or phenylbenzene, is an organic compound with the
chemical formula (C6H5)2. It is an aromatic hydrocarbon consisting of two
phenyl rings joined by a single bond. At room temperature, biphenyl is a white
crystalline solid with a characteristic pleasant odor. Its key properties
include high thermal stability, good heat transfer capabilities, and low
toxicity compared to some other industrial chemicals. These attributes make it
a valuable compound across various industrial applications.

Key Drivers Propelling Market Growth
Several significant factors are contributing to the growth
of the biphenyl market:
- Demand
for Heat Transfer Fluids: Biphenyl, often used in eutectic mixtures
with diphenyl ether (e.g., Dowtherm A), is an excellent high-temperature
heat transfer fluid. Its application in chemical processing, petrochemical
industries, oil & gas, and power generation (especially in concentrated
solar power plants) is a major market driver due to its efficiency and
stability at elevated temperatures.
- Chemical
Intermediate in Organic Synthesis: Biphenyl serves as a crucial
intermediate in the production of a wide range of organic chemicals,
including dyes, optical brighteners, pharmaceuticals, and liquid crystal
polymers. The growth of these downstream industries directly fuels the
demand for biphenyl.
- Fungicidal
Applications: Biphenyl is effective as a fungicide, particularly for
preserving citrus fruits during storage and transport. The increasing
global trade of agricultural produce and the need for post-harvest
protection contribute to its demand in this segment.
- Specialty
Chemical Manufacturing: Its unique chemical structure allows for its
use in various specialty chemical formulations, including flame retardants
and as a component in certain plastics and resins.
- Industrial
Expansion: The overall growth of industrial sectors, particularly in
developing economies, which require efficient heat transfer solutions and
chemical intermediates, indirectly boosts the biphenyl market.
